Title: Innovations of Thomas Bartsch

Introduction

Thomas Bartsch is a notable inventor based in Niedernhausen, Germany. He holds a total of four patents, showcasing his contributions to the field of engineering and technology. His work primarily focuses on advancements in automotive systems and pressure management devices.

Latest Patents

One of Bartsch's latest patents is the "Pulsation Damping Capsule." This invention features a hermetically sealed metal membrane housing made of two concave hemispheres. The design allows for the separation of an inner space from a surrounding pressure medium, enabling the capsule to function as an energy accumulator with spring elasticity. This pulsation damping device is engineered to withstand stresses while being simple to produce, allowing for easy customization to existing conditions.

Another significant patent is the "Motor-Pump Unit" for motor vehicle brake systems. This unit comprises a motor and a pump, with a shaft driven by the motor. The shaft is rotatably mounted in an accommodating member that includes valves and connecting channels. Bartsch's design improves the vacuum filling of the brake system with pressure fluid by incorporating a free space at the shaft end, along with a connection between this space and the chamber.
